SB 1426: Planning and zoning: annual report.

California · Senate · 2025–2026 Regular Session · last verified July 20, 2026

What SB 1426 does, verified July 20, 2026

This bill amends various sections of the Government Code to improve the annual report requirements for land use and planning. The report must include information on the status of land disposal, the number of applications for parcel maps, and other relevant data. The bill also reorganizes the requirements to make the process more efficient. Additionally, it declares the bill to take effect immediately, as an urgency statute, allowing it to go into effect sooner.
